Public Utilities Specialist (Contracts)
- Bonneville Power Administration (Vancouver, WA)
-
Summary This position is located with Bonneville Power Administration (BPA), in Transmission Account Services (TSES) organization of Transmission Sales (TSE), Transmission Marketing & Sales (TS), Transmission Services (T). A successful candidate in the Senior Public Utilities Specialist (Contracts) position is responsible for long-term transmission contract development, quality assurance review, finalization and administration, analysis, assisting with customer issues. Responsibilities As a Public Utilities Specialist (Contracts), you will: Acquire data and perform analyses to support contract negotiations. Coordinate stakeholder reviews of draft and final contract actions. Review draft and final analyses, contract actions, communications, etc., to ensure quality assurance standards are met, and agency and business policies, procedures, and standards are adhered to. Assist the Transmission Sales team with resolving transmission customer issues. Serve as a subject matter expert and technical lead in the formulation of strategy and operational requirements to support contract development and finalization, contract quality control review, analysis, customer issue resolution and contract administration. Develop, guide, coordinate, and lead initiatives related to contract negotiation, drafting, finalization, and analysis. Evaluate and provide expert advice on the impact of policy approaches and changes, rate changes, business practice changes, new products and services, and/or other proposals affecting long-term transmission agreements. Serve as a mentor and resource for peers and as a trainer within the organization. Qualifications Qualifications: S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S A qualified candidate's res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ience equivalent to the next lower grade level (GS-12) in the Federal service. Specialized experience for this position is defined as experience in negotiating, developing, monitoring, and renewing/terminating contracts, as well as analyzing customer requirements, performing technical evaluations, and coordinating stakeholder reviews to finalize contracts for the sale of products and services consistent with business standards, policies, and procedures.
